Next is Becky's fun 'sailboat' card.  She used the Let's Set Sail Bundle seen here.  

Her colors are Night of Navy, Parakeet Party & Sahara Sand.  The DSP is from the Sun Prints.  It's a fancy fold too!  

Notice her clouds on the background?  She used the Friends are Like Seashells stamps for those!  So clever! 

Measurements:

  • The card base is 4 1/4" X 11" scored at 5 1/2". 
  • The long strip is 1 1/2" X 11" scored at 2 3/4", 5 1/2" & 8 1/4" and is adhered only at the two end pieces.  
  • The squares are 1 3/4" & 2" in size.  

Next is a wonderful card made by Monica.  She used the Dragonfly Garden stamp set & coordinating Dragonflies punch.

Details:

  • Her colors include Soft Suede, Soft Succulent & Evening Evergreen.  She textured the various strips using the new Painted Posies 3D embossing folder. 
  • The strips are all 4 3/4" long but vary in width from 5/8" – 1 1/4" all adhered to a 4" X 5 1/4" piece of White CS.  Again, strips to the rescue for a unique background idea; perfect for men.  
  • The greeting die-cuts are from the Stitched Rectangle dies. 
  • The dragonfly is stamped on Vellum and punched out. But she stamped it again on a piece of the Texture Chic specialty DSP for the center.  So it has gold details on it!

    Who wouldn't like to receive a shaker card?!  They're fun, shakable and hard to resist playing with. 

    I made a bunch of these for our July Team card swap featuring 'window sheets'. I love the fact that I could get multiple, colorful die-cut flowers with the Extraordinary Floral Washi Tape and the coordinating die-cut. Just add it to another piece of cardstock and die-cut. So fast & EASY! 

    Notice the sponged green designer paper above. That is the Irresistible Designs 12" DSP seen here.  I added Olive ink to it with a Blending Brush; the printed embossed designs 'resist' the ink.  Pretty cool! 

    I used the Paper Tags stamp set – stamping the greeting directly onto the window sheet with Black Stazon ink. Then I turned it over to add a bit of Flirty Flamingo blends marker on the 'celebrate' part.  

    My colors include Flirty Flamingo, Old Olive and White for a fresh floral card design. Want to know the steps to achieve a shaker card?  Best to grab the free project sheet below or watch the video tutorial.

    Today I have another stunning Team card swap made by Tracey featuring Window Sheets. She featured the Beautiful Butterflies bundle seen here:

    Her colors include Shy Shamrock with Petunia Pop, Black, White & Gold embossing. 

    Here's how she made this card:

    1. Texture the White layer with the Hybrid embossing folder; add to the Petunia layer and the card base. 
    2. Ink the butterfly image in Versamark and stamp on the Window sheet. Heat emboss with Gold embossing powder. Die-cut with the coordinating die.  *she did say some of the embossing powder on the edge frayed off when it went through the die-cut.  
    3. Color the back of the butterfly with Blends markers.  Adhere to the White cardstock layer with Foam Strip adhesive in the center only. Add the center 'body' die-cut.
    4. Heat emboss the greeting onto the Black strip with White embossing powder.  Finish with gems. 

    Here's the full bundle that includes stamps, dies and a Hybrid embossing folder. What is a 'Hybrid Embossing folder?  It's where you can cut AND emboss/texture at the same time!

    And look how she finished the inside!  She used the Baby Wipe technique to achieve a multi-colored butterfly.
